Commented Unassigned: MCE Buddy won't process any video files - Gets stuck "Re-ReMuxing due to audio error" [1628]

$
0
0
I am unable to process any video, and the program gets stuck in a cycle of constantly "Re-ReMuxing due to audio error". I am currently using version 2.3 (Release 12), and have the same problem using both x32 and x64 version of MCE Buddy. I also accepted all the prompts during installation to add (e.g. FFDShow, Haali Media Splitter, ShowAnalyser Suite).

I am trying to process UK broadcasted films recorded in WMCentre, and ideally would just like to remove/trim out the adverts and leave the video files in their original WTV format (Which also avoids lengthy video conversion).
I am having the same re-remuxing issue across a range of several different movies I have tried to process.

MY PC is a very recent i-7 Haswell build, with 250GB SSD, 8GB RAM, so I think it's unlikely to be a hardware issue.

Please can you advise how I can troubleshoot this issue.
See the attached for an example log of one of the various films I have been trying to process.

Thanks again for the quick reply - I think I understand the issue now... I found this comment you had contributed on one of the other threads which I thought I would add here for everyone's benefit (Below).

> "Okay for those folks who are not able to play back WTV files encoded by MCEBuddy I've found out why. It's FFDSHOW, somewhere ffdshow is breaking WTV playback.
I've isolated part of it, ffdshow video decoder configuration ->MPEG2 -> set to Disabled (this is what causes the crash). Now it should not crash WMP or MCE anymore.
However I have noticed on 1 computer this causes the video playback not to work. That's something ffdshow has broken. I haven't found a workaround for it but you can try uninstaling ffdshow and see if it helps otherwise the best bet is to reinstall windows (it works perfectly on a clean installation) and DO NOT INSTALL FFDSHOW as it it break WTV playback.
i will be removing the prompt to install ffdshow in the next build of mcebuddy"

To make this work, do you mean a clean Windows install - That seems a bit extreme?
If I can avoid it I would rather not do a total clean install from scratch, as this takes hours with all the additional programs and custom settings in various programs like Windows Media Centre, and Media Browser... Surely there must be some other way to troubleshoot this, such as un-installing FFDShow and setting Codecs back to default settings... Would this work / Any suggestions?

Alternatively, can you recommend what are the optimal settings in MCE Buddy for an alternative to unprocessed WTV files, perhaps mp4?? Like many others, ideally I am trying to achieve minimum processing time, while maintaining the video files as close as possible to their original format recorded in Windows Media Centre, which is why I had chosen WTV unprocessed format originally.
